Breaking News

Friday, 6 November 2015

Program Pengurangan,Penjumlahan,Perkalian Dan Pembagian Dengan Vb.Net


MENGGUNAKAN OPERATOR 
VISUAL BASIC .NET

1. Operator Aritmetika

Operator Aritmetika digunakan untuk melakukam opearasi matematika  
Daftar Operator Aritmetika

Opertor Aritmetika

Operasi yang dilakukan

+

Penjumlahan

-

Pengurangan

*

Perkalian

/

Pembagian dengan Hasil Bulat

^

Pangkat

Mod

Menghitung sisa pembagian



2. Operator Penugasan

Operator Penugasan berfungsi untuk memasukan nilai dari suatu ekspresi ke ekspresi yang lain, operator penugasan digunakan dengan symbol (=)


3. Operator Pembanding

Operator pembanding berfungsi untuk membandingkan suatu nilai dengan nilai yang lain dimana hasilnya akan menghasilkan nilai logika TRUE dan FALSE

Daftar Operator Pembanding

Operator Pembanding

Keterangan

=

Sama dengan

> 

Lebih Besar Dari

< 

Lebih Kecil Dari

<> 

Tidak Sama dengan

<=

Lebih Kecil atau sama dengan

>=

Lebih besar atau sama dengan

Between

Menentukan antara nilai

Like

Pencarian dengan pola

In

Mencari      data     dengan      nilai tertentu


 
4. Operator Logika

Oprator logika berfungsi untuk menentukan hasil berupa nilai Tru and False
Daftar Operator Logika

Operator Logika

And

Or

Xor

Not



Praktikum

Pada pembuatan aplikasi ini, objek-objek yang digunakan , namenya dirubah dengan nama yang di anjurkan, kemudian propertisnya diaturpula dengan criteria 

Buatlah Tampilan Berikut ini:




 Penyelesaian:
1. Atur Propertinya sbb:



No.

Objek

Properti

Nilai Properti

1.

Solution Explorer Form1

Name Name
StartPosition

Latihan 2 Frlatihan2 CenterScreen

2.

GroupBox1

Label1 Label2 Label3 Textbox1 Textbox2 Textbox3

Text Dock Text Text Text Name Name Name

| Data Bilangan | Top
Bilangan Kesatu Bilangan Kedua Hasil Perhitungan txtBil1
txtBil2 txtHasil

3.

GroupBox2

Button1

Text Dock Name Text

| Operator | Bottom btTambah
+

 


Button2


Button3


Button4


Button5


Button6

TextAlign Name  
Text TextAlign Name  
Text TextAlign Name  
Text TextAlign Name  
Text TextAlign Name  
Text TextAlign
MiddleCenter btKurang
-MiddleCenter btKali
x MiddleCenter btBagi
/ MiddleCenter btNew
&New MiddleCenter btClose &Close MiddleCenter




Tambahkan kode program berikut

Public Class frLatihan2

Private Sub frAritmatika_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
'--- mengisi properti objek Form
Me.Text = "Latihan Perhitungan Aritmatika"

End Sub
'--- mengisi event & method terhadap tombol proses Private Sub btTambah_Click(ByVal sender As System.Object,
ByVal e As System.EventArgs) Handles btTambah.Click Dim b1, b2 As New Integer
Dim h As New Double
b1 = Val(txtBil1.Text)  
b2 = Val(txtBil2.Text) 
h = b1 + b2  
txtHasil.Text = h
End Sub

Private Sub btKurang_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btKurang.Click
Dim b1, b2 As New Integer Dim h As New Double
b1 = Val(txtBil1.Text)  
b2 = Val(txtBil2.Text)  
h = b1 - b2 
txtHasil.Text = h
End Sub

Private Sub btKali_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btKali.Click
Dim b1, b2 As New Integer Dim h As New Double
b1 = Val(txtBil1.Text)  
b2 = Val(txtBil2.Text)  
h = b1 * b2 
txtHasil.Text = h
End Sub 
 
Private Sub btBagi_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btBagi.Click
Dim b1, b2 As New Integer Dim h As New Double
b1 = Val(txtBil1.Text) 
b2 = Val(txtBil2.Text)  
h = b1 / b2 
txtHasil.Text = h
End Sub

Private Sub btNew_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btNew.Click
Me.txtBil1.Clear() Me.txtBil2.Clear() Me.txtHasil.Clear() Me.txtBil1.Focus()
End Sub

Private Sub btClose_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btClose.Click
Me.Close() 
 End Sub

Private Sub txtBil1_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les txtBil1.KeyPress
If e.KeyChar = Chr(13) Then Me.txtBil2.Focus()
End If  
End Sub
Private Sub txtBil2_KeyPress(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les txtBil2.KeyPress
If e.KeyChar = Chr(13) Then Me.btNew.Focus()
End If  
End Sub

End Class
  



 Selamat Program Anda Telah Selesai.. ;-)



Selalu Gunakan Nama yang sama dengan yang ada di modul agar anda mudah dalam melakukan pengecekan kesalahan di dalam form


 Selamat Mencoba  !!!!







Read more ...
Designed By